If I quote say £550 profit costs for a conveyancing purchase, presumably it is acceptable on the final bill to allocate £500 to the purchase and £50 for advising on the search results. After all, for years I have included advising on the searches as part of my retainer. Not to do so would be negligent.

If I add VAT onto both items exactly in accordance with my quote and show the disbursements paid out, how can HMRC then ask for extra VAT on search results. It is all part of the service for which I am adding the full amount of VAT. This is a puzzling decision.
